S-1: James Maritime Holdings Inc. Files S-1 for Potential Public Offering

Sentiment:

S-1 Filing


James Maritime Holdings Inc. has filed an S-1 registration statement with the SEC for a potential public offering involving the resale of up to 3,185,000 shares of its common stock by selling security holders.

Worse than expectedThe company reported a net loss of $2,618,965 for 2023, compared to net income of $113,445 for 2022.The company's accumulated deficit increased from $11,454,076 in 2022 to $13,915,927 in 2023.

Summary

  • James Maritime Holdings Inc. has filed an S-1 registration statement with the SEC.
  • The filing pertains to the proposed resale of up to 3,185,000 shares of common stock by existing selling security holders.
  • The shares include 2,885,000 outstanding shares and 1,050,000 shares issuable upon exercise of warrants.
  • The company will not receive any proceeds from the sale of shares by the selling security holders, but will receive approximately $2,887,000 upon the cash exercise of the Purchase Warrants.
  • The company is an emerging growth company and a smaller reporting company, which allows for reduced disclosure requirements.
  • The company's business strategy involves growth through strategic acquisitions in the private security, personnel protective equipment, and defense industries.
  • The company operates through its subsidiaries, Gladiator Solutions Inc. and United Security Specialists, Inc.

Legal Proceedings

  • The Company is subject to litigation claims arising in the ordinary course of business.
  • The Company was engaged in litigation with Strategic Funding Source, Inc. d/b/a Kapitus, a New York Corporation as Plaintiff against Gladiator Solutions, Inc. an Arizona Corporation, James Maritime Holdings, Inc. a Nevada Corporation and Matthew C. Materazo an individual Cas No. 24cv438754, with an unlimited Civil Cross-Complaint Gladiator Solutions, Inc. an Arizona Corporation, James Maritime Holdings, Inc. a Nevada Corporation Cross-Complainants vs. Matthew C. Materazo.
  • This litigation involves a dispute over financing that was procured without approval or knowledge of the Company by Matthew C. Materazo to the detriment of Gladiator Solutions, Inc. and its shareholders.

Key Dates

DateDescription
March 18, 1992Company was originally incorporated as Out-Takes, Inc. in Delaware.
January 23, 2015Company was incorporated in Nevada.
February 17, 2015Out-Takes changed its domicile from Delaware to Nevada.
July 8, 2017United Security Specialists, Inc. was incorporated.
December 13, 2021Company entered into a share exchange agreement with Gladiator Solutions, Inc.
June 11, 2022Company entered into a share exchange agreement with United Security Specialists, Inc.
July 17, 2024Company effectuated a name change from James Maritime Holdings, Inc. to Sentinel Holdings Ltd.
September 24, 2024Last reported price of common stock was $6.00 per share.
